Recently, the interest in home daycare services happens to be increasing. With more plus parents pursuing versatile and inexpensive childcare choices, house daycare providers have grown to be a well known choice for many people. But as with every style of childcare arrangement, you can find both advantages and disadvantages to think about regarding house daycare.

One of many great things about house daycare could be the personalized attention and care that young ones get. Unlike bigger daycare facilities, residence daycare providers typically have smaller groups of kiddies to care for, letting them provide each child more individualized attention. This is especially beneficial for children whom may need additional help or have unique requirements. Also, residence daycare providers frequently have even more freedom inside their schedules, permitting them to accommodate the requirements of working moms and dads who may have non-traditional work hours.

In property daycare environment, young ones are able to play and discover in a comfortable and familiar environment, which will help them feel better and comfortable. This can be specifically beneficial for younger kids just who may have trouble with separation anxiety when being kept in a larger, more institutionalized daycare environment.

Residence daycare providers in addition often have more freedom regarding curriculum and activities. In property daycare setting, providers have the freedom to modify their particular programs towards the particular needs and passions of this young ones inside their care. This will probably permit more creative and personalized learning experiences, which may be good for children of most many years.

Despite these benefits, additionally there are some downsides to consider with regards to home daycare. One of the most significant issues that parents could have could be the decreased supervision and legislation in house daycare facilities. This will boost concerns concerning the quality and security of care that kiddies get during these options.

Another possible downside of house daycare may be the limited socialization options that kiddies may have. In a property daycare environment, children are usually only interacting with a little band of peers, that may not give them the exact same standard of socialization and exposure to diverse experiences they would receive in a more substantial daycare center. This can be an issue for parents whom worth socialization and peer interaction as important the different parts of their child's development.

In addition, house daycare providers may deal with difficulties with regards to managing their caregiving obligations with their personal resides. Numerous home daycare providers tend to be self-employed that will struggle to discover a work-life balance, especially if these are typically caring for children in their own personal domiciles. This could cause burnout and anxiety, which can fundamentally affect the grade of care that kids obtain.

In general, house daycare may be outstanding option for people hunting for versatile and tailored childcare choices. But is essential for moms and dads to carefully consider the benefits and drawbacks of home daycare before making a decision. By weighing the professionals and cons of home daycare and doing thorough research on prospective providers, moms and dads can make certain that they are choosing the best childcare option for kids.

Finally, home daycare can be a valuable and enriching knowledge for the kids, supplying all of them with customized treatment, a home-like environment, and flexible development. However, moms and dads should become aware of the possibility disadvantages, eg restricted supervision and socialization options, and do something to ensure they've been selecting an established and top-quality home daycare supplier. With consideration and study, residence daycare is a confident and gratifying childcare choice for many households.
